Question

State two ways through which the strength of an electromagnet can be increased.

Advertisements

Solution

the strength of an electromagnet can be increased by following ways:
(i) By increasing the number of turns of winding in the solenoid.
(ii) By increasing the current through the solenoid.

A transformer is essentially an a.c. device. It cannot work on d.c. It changes alternating voltages or currents. It does not affect the frequency of a.c. It is based on the phenomenon of mutual induction. A transformer essentially consists of two coils of insulated copper wire having different numbers of turns and wound on the same soft iron core.
